    Abstract: An apparatus for drying, pyrolyzing and possibly also gasifying of lump wood in a cylindrical vessel with a hearth case includes a vessel of a type which differs from prior art vessel units by a top cooling hood with an annular cooling duct and an outer annular air space for preheating suction air and an inner, likewise annular, gas space to discharge to some external destination the gas recovered from the predried wood. The air drawn from the outer annular space is fed to the hearth via an air chamber and nozzles. Condensate precipitated on the inside faces of the hood drops into an annular gutter and is subjected to evaporation in the further course of the process. A method for operating this apparatus is also provided.

    Abstract: Pure silicon is obtained in a semicontinuous process by reducing quartz sand with aluminum in a slag medium based on alkaline earth metal silicates. The slag serves thereby simultaneously as a solvent for the aluminum oxide that forms and as an extraction medium for impurities that occur. The silicon formed separates out of the silicate slag and can be separated off. The aluminum oxide produced by the reduction can be separated from the slag and used for recovery of reusable aluminum.

    Abstract: A system and method for measuring the heat emission of space heaters includes an input device for selectively inputting special heater constants Q.sub.N and n, which are characteristic space heaters associated therewith. The device is coupled to a processor which, in operation, receives the temperature values T.sub.V, T.sub.R and T.sub.i sensed by a supply temperature sensor, a return temperature sensor, and an ambient temperature sensor. A timer provides the clock signal for the processor. The processor develops an output representing a quantitative measure for the heat consumption of the associated heater from the preadjusted characteristic constants, Q.sub.N and n, and the sensed temperature values, T.sub.V, T.sub.R and T.sub.i. The processor is programmed so as to also serve as correction device for automatically correcting any throttle states of the heater in operation.

    Abstract: A sluice apparatus intended for dosed introduction of abrasive or rubbing elements into, and removal from, a liquid-carrying pipe or tube line system includes a drum-like collecting vessel with three connecting valves--namely, two continuous flow valves and one catcher valve. Disposed inside the vessel is an apertured catcher basket which is spaced from the inside wall of the vessel and which has the geometry of a partial drum with two side plates. Its upper end is secured by means of holding tubes adapted to be supported on holding pins so that the basket can be easily inserted and withdrawn.

    Abstract: A device for providing pulsation-free feeding of a liquid medium from a supply container to a consuming device for use in a road-marking machine is disclosed. Two statically-operating reciprocating-piston pumps are arranged between the supply container and the consuming device such that when one pump is on suction stroke, the other is on a feed stroke. The pump flow rate is proportional to the drive speed of the road-marking machine and the feed flow of each pump has zones which overlap the other. The feed sides of the pumps are connected to a change-over means which alternately connects delivery flows from the pumps to the consuming device and also connects the pressure side of the pumps simultaneously to the consuming device and to the supply container, which prevents pressure flow fluctuations as the back-pressure to each pump is the same.

    Abstract: The invention makes it possible to manufacture silicon wafers having vertical p-n junctions as the basic material for solar cells. As a result of simultaneously adding certain dopants that act in the silicon crystal as donors and certain dopants that develop acceptor properties and also as a result of measures that result in a periodic change in the crystal growth from a low rate v.sub.n to a high rate v.sub.n, p- and n-conductive zones are produced in the silicon, each having a total length of from 5 to 2000 .mu.m.
